Transaction 6342fbdf71bced3248993cbe6282582618be8907e54a9fa39cd1cc9ba1b86259

1 Input
2 Outputs
  • 6342fbdf71bced3248993cbe6282582618be8907e54a9fa39cd1cc9ba1b86259:0
  • value  5372853
    address  3Ls4RrZPbEUu6dR3rqNVpuuCVsVbR4wviN
  • 6342fbdf71bced3248993cbe6282582618be8907e54a9fa39cd1cc9ba1b86259:1
  • value  150214
    address  1PueJiSjt21gKAwqW3JKuDbPjoMLvnV8pA